							Hello there, car runs perfectly before i change the oil. I bought some 10W-40 oil and RYCO filter from supercheap,but after changing the oil, the engine start to make some strange noise. I don`t know how to describe that, it just like there is some water in the engine. sound like a dish washer  .... oil pressure normal, engine got power and not overheat. The sound is come from oil fan. My engine has 220,000 on it, Is it on it`s way to die? what can i do?   | ||

							Sounds like its overfilled and the crank is hitting the oil in the pan. How much did you drain out of it? I just realised its a V8. 10-40 is too thin for a 5.0 with 220k on it especially in summer. Go a 20-50.
